Career path
| Career Role in Nutrigenomics & Nutritional Biochemistry (UK) | Description |
|---|---|
| Registered Nutritional Therapist (Nutrigenomics Specialist) | Develops personalized nutrition plans based on an individual's genetic profile and biochemical markers. High demand for expertise in gut microbiome analysis. |
| Research Scientist (Nutritional Biochemistry) | Conducts research on the interaction between nutrition, genes, and health outcomes. Focus on developing novel functional foods and supplements. |
| Clinical Nutritionist (Nutrigenomics Focus) | Works within healthcare settings, advising patients on diet and lifestyle modifications based on nutrigenomic insights and blood biochemistry. Excellent communication skills crucial. |
| Consultant in Nutrigenomics | Provides expert advice to food companies, health institutions, and individuals on the applications of nutrigenomics. Requires advanced understanding of metabolic pathways and gene expression. |
